## Tuning

Mergewell's dedupe pass is conservative by default: it only merges customer records above the match-score cutoff and defers ambiguous pairs to the review queue. If the queue backs up overnight, raise the batch size before touching thresholds. The defaults shipped with this release are the following.

tuning table, bahaf-kadup:
QUOTAS = {
    "fenir": 854,
    "fraath": 934,
    "pelys": 955,
}

Subject: Handover — Paylattice retry signing

Hi Moreno,

Before I roll off: the Paylattice retry worker attaches idempotency keys to every payment retry, derived from the original charge envelope. Do not regenerate these on redeploy, or duplicate charges slip through. The envelope signer validates each retry batch before submission, and it must be re-armed after any restart. To re-arm it, load the signing key that follows.

deploy key for kajof-fajop: bky6_gDHw9Q

Ticket KSK-207: Kiosk watchdog misconfigured on Ferndale pilot units

For review: the Ovenbird kiosk watchdog was pointed at the wrong heartbeat endpoint, so it rebooted healthy units every ten minutes. The corrected env file sets `WATCHDOG_HEARTBEAT_PATH=/health/live` and `WATCHDOG_INTERVAL=60`. Per our convention, the watchdog's reporting secret must appear on the line directly following those settings. Insert it here.

sealed setting: ARCHIVE_KEY3=8d0

Handover — Torvald Transcode Farm

Welcome aboard. The farm runs 14 nodes in the Brellhaven rack; jobs come in through the Splicer queue and fan out by codec. Most things are self-healing, but if the scheduler loses quorum you'll need to re-initialize the coordinator manually. That step asks for the operator passphrase before it will rejoin nodes. Keep it somewhere safe and never paste it into chat. For reference during onboarding, it is listed below.

unlock words, kagup-kajop: sordor-ulawyn-kasax-silmir-juldor-kelix-tamius-zorael-ulaax-raleth-wenys-quenwyn-pelys